Scheme of Examination

1.Candidates need to attempt the MAH-AR-CET (Common Admission Test) for admission to 5 year degree course in Architecture in Government Aided Colleges or Unaided Colleges who have given consent for the CAT and CAP (Centralized Admission Process)

2. The MAH-AR-CET-2013 examination will consist of one common question paper of maximum 200 marks in the subjects of Aesthetic Sensitivity and Drawing to test the aptitude of the candidate for architecture degree course.

3. The Paper Pattern is as follows:

Aesthetic Sensitivity Section will have 7 questions for 100 marks.

Drawing Section will have 2 questions for 100 marks.

6. There are about 8 colleges that admit students to 427 seats across Maharashtra based on MAH-AR-CET marks.MH-AR-CET-Seat distribution

7. The questions will be set only in English, not in any other language.

8.Approximately 5,300 students apply for the exam. The exam is for 3 hours.

Eligibility for Candidates applying for MAH-AR-CET

10. The minimum qualification for appearing for MAH-AR-CET is passed or appearing for 10+2 (Class XII) or equivalent exam (Read more) with minimum 50% aggregate marks (45% for OBC, SC, ST & PH category) and Mathematics as a compulsory subject.

11. The marks for MAH-AR-CET 2012 will be considered for admission for the current academic year 2012-13 only. There is no provision for carry forward of results.

12. Candidates should attain minimum 40% or 80 marks (35% or 70 marks for OBC, SC, ST and PH Category) in the MAH-AR-CET to become eligible to participate in the Centralized Admission Process (CAP).

13. There are separate eligibility criteria for Foreign Nationals or NRIs, J&K Migrants, GoI candidates, children of defence personnel. Please refer to details in Information Brochure.
